What to Anticipate

You will service approximately 12 to 14 residences daily. Routes will be organized for you each day, allowing you to build rapport with your clients over time.

Your responsibilities will include performing detailed inspections of residential properties to identify entry points for pests and assess any infestations, followed by devising suitable treatment strategies. Clear communication with clients regarding your findings, treatment options, preventive measures, and additional services will be essential to ensure their homes remain pest-free.

Occasionally, you may need to visit our warehouse for meetings, training sessions, or to replenish supplies.
